Rollator Walker Type 3 wheeled rollator walkers

Three-wheeled Walkers are more maneuverable in smaller areas, but they are less stable than models with four wheels. The brakes are usually a push-down type that activates when the user leans against the frame.

Brakes

It is crucial to choose the right rollator with Adjustable height that has a top braking system. These brakes work differently than standard walker brakes, and provide more stability to users. They also minimize the chance of damage to the walker. They are a great option for those who frequently use their walker or on slippery or uneven surfaces.

Most rollators come with handbrakes in the style of bicycles that can be easily locked and engaged to stop the walker. To activate the brakes, simply squeeze the levers on the handles of each. If you have trouble squeezing the levers, search for models with grips made of rubber or foam covers to minimize hand discomfort. They are also easier to hold and won't slide if your hands sweat.

Some rollators have brakes that work by pushing down or using your weight. This makes it easy to control the speed using your body. These are great for those who find it difficult to press hand brakes. This includes petite users and individuals with impaired dexterity or memory.

If you're looking for an enduring braking system consider a walker with brakes made of high-quality materials such as polyurethane or rubber. These brakes are resistant to abrasion, and can last longer than the plastic ones found on a lot of walkers that are cheaper. They're also quieter and won't make any distracting noises while in motion.

A lot of these models come with an adjustment screw for brakes or knob that allows you fine-tune the sensitivity of your brake. Ensuring that the nut is tight increases the sensitivity, while loosening decreases it. After adjusting the brakes check them to make sure they're operating properly. If they're not holding securely, adjust them until you find the perfect setting for your requirements.
